Click here to learn more about Mexico Risk and Security.Ī multitude of threats exist within Mexico, as per any other LATAM country. More than ever before, business travelers unaware of the risk distinctions from district to district, and neighborhood to neighborhood are either placing themselves at unprecedented risk or missing out on closing deals in places where the risk is manageable. Corporate security organizations wedded to general travel advice for Mexican regions will not only find themselves saying “No” to business opportunities in safer towns but saying “Yes” to potentially life-threatening visits to villages that should be off-limits. For example, risk levels in Cancun are not nearly the same as Monterrey.

Rather, Mexico travel risk must be viewed through the lens of locality. The business traveler to Mexico is ill-served by a national or regional level risk assessment approach.
